August 11, 2022Keeping The Crown Hotel Loud w/ Taylor McGregor: 12th August, 2022Earlier this week saw a march in the Octagon of Otepoti Dunedin, advocating for the safety of the Crown Hotel The music venue has been at risk due to plans for a housing developer to build a new residential area nearby, banning the Crown Hotel from making the noise it needs to.To learn more, Liam spoke to bFM’s own Taylor McGregor, also from Save Our Venues, about the venue and the issues of the new development. ...more10minPlay
August 11, 2022Cost Of Living and Health w/ Dr Stephen Child: August 12th, 2022It’s not breaking news that the Cost-of-Living has been messed up across the country. However, new reports are showing the affects the financial difficulties are having on our physical and emotional health.The Southern Cross's most recent Healthy Futures Report has shown direct links through several measures, such as people having difficulty sleeping, feeling more stressed, and having more difficulty affording health care.To learn more Liam spoke to Chief Medical Officer of Southern Cross Insurance Arm Doctor Stephen Child....more10minPlay
